Way TOO Loud
Strengths: It's a normal HD, not that different from other good quality 7200 RPM 16BM cache HDs.
Weaknesses: LOUD, LOUD, LOUD.
Review:  It performs well but just not that much better than a good 16Mb cache 7200RPM hard drive. You would definitely be better off with 2x160GB 7200RPM HDs in RAID and it would be cheaper too. Regret purchasing because it is super loud. It screams like a dying pig. Western Digital Raptor WD740ADFD 74GB 10K RPM
Strengths: It is fast and you can't go wrong with a 5 year warranty!!
Weaknesses: The price and is a tad bit louder than my old drive, but that can be expected from a 10K RPM drive.
Review: I bought this since my main HD died. I am basically going to use this as a main program drive/boot. It also helps that it has a 5 year warranty just in case. This raptor does wonders with my gaming rig. If you are going to use this for intense HD use (running multiple applications that needs to frequently access to the drive) this drive is for you.

Raptor X, the enthusiast\\\\\\\'s drive.
Strengths: Fast, no problems running two of these in Raid 0, looks tight in the right cases
Weaknesses: Expensive for the amount of space, Louder than most other sata hard drives.
Review: Raid 0 with these makes everything run very snappy. I would recommend them to enthusiasts and those seeking the best. There are a few cases out there that show these off like my Thermaltake does. There was still a little modding involved to get the window to be seen. Vibration dampening was a nice touch for these hard drives.
